Welcome to the University of Southampton Astronomy Society, AstroSoc. We are a group of amateur astronomers studying at the University of Southampton. We welcome anyone at the University with an interest in astronomy - no prior experience required. Our members are always happy to help newcomers learn the ropes, from how to read the sky to how to set up and use a telescope.So... why not come down and have a go? We normally meet every Monday inside the SUSU building, and provided the skies are clear, we head out onto the common to observe. However, if the British weather is up to its usual tricks then we have other activities such as quizzes and astronomy talks - or we just head down to a local pub for a catch up! Throughout the year we try to organise other activities, such as cinema trips or visits to astronomical places of interest.
